Kotlin reflection API invocation on a specific function
may require iterating on all Java methods to find the right
Kotlin function. As a consequence, this commit adds introspection
hints on the class declared methods for all Kotlin beans since
the impact on the footprint is low.

This commit infers the reflection hints required for converters
when they are specified with the @Convert annotation at class or
field level.
It also refines the hints generated for @Converter in order
to just generate the construct hint, not the public method one
which should be not needed.

Prior to this commit, extracting the path within handler mapping would
result in "" if the matching path element would be a Regex and contain
".*". This could cause issues with resource handling if the handler
mapping pattern was similar to `"/folder/file.*.extension"`.
This commit introduces a new `isLiteral()` method in the `PathElement`
abstract class that expresses whether the path element can be compared
as a String for path matching or if it requires a more elaborate
matching process.
Using this method for extracting the path within handler mapping avoids
relying on wildcard count or other properties.
